About The Role

The Quality Engineer is crucial for ensuring our manufacturing processes and products consistently meet the highest quality standards. You'll be responsible for establishing effective quality control systems, conducting thorough root cause analyses, and leading continuous improvement initiatives. Success in this position requires strong problem-solving skills, proven capability to deliver process effectiveness, meticulous attention to detail, and a collaborative approach with cross-functional teams to boost product performance, process capability, and production efficiency.

What You'll Accomplish
  • Develop, implement, and maintain quality control processes in manufacturing using PFMEA, PCPs, QMS, and Lean principles.
  • Monitor and analyze production process capability to ensure compliance with industry standards (ISO, Six Sigma, etc.).
  • Conduct root cause analysis and corrective/preventive actions (CAPA) for quality issues.
  • Perform internal and supplier audits to ensure adherence to quality requirements.
  • Collaborate with design, production, and supply chain teams to improve product and process quality.
  • Establish and maintain documentation for quality standards, procedures, and inspections via ISO9001 standards.
  • Utilize statistical process control (SPC) & six sigma tools to identify trends and improve manufacturing efficiency; measuring and improving capability is fundamental.
  • Demonstrate a commitment to communicating, improving, and adhering to health, safety, and environmental policies in all work environments and areas. Promote a culture of safety and exhibit these behaviors.
